An Act to grant certain duties of Customs and Inland Revenue (including Excise), to alter other duties, and to amend the law relating to Customs and Inland Revenue (including Excise) and the National Debt, and to make further provision in connection with finance.

(1)Where an application is made for a direction under section fifty-five of the M1National Debt Act, 1870 (which, as extended by paragraph 6 of the Third Schedule to the M2Finance Act, 1921, relates to unclaimed stock, dividends and principal moneys payable on redemption) either—
(a)for the re-transfer of any stock the nominal value whereof exceeds twenty pounds; or
(b)for the payment of any dividends or other moneys amounting in all to more than twenty pounds;
the direction may, if the [F10Registrar of Government Stock] thinks fit, be witheld until three months after public notice of the application has been given by advertisement in such manner and containing such particulars as he may direct.

(1)This Act may be cited as the Finance Act, 1937.
(2). .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. F18
(3). .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. F19
(4)Any reference in this Act to any other enactment shall be construed as a reference to that enactment as amended by any subsequent enactment, including (unless the context otherwise requires) this Act.
(5)Such of the provisions of this Act as relate to matters with respect to which the Parliament of Northern Ireland has power to make laws shall not extend to Northern Ireland.
